ST tires are new at having speed letters and having the testing ability to sustain the speed letter displayed on their sidewalls. Almost all of them now have ratings at 75 MPH ("L") or higher.

To be allowed to sport the DOT on the tire sidewall, somewhere along the line each designated size was tested.

It's my opinion that the DOT would not allow speed letters on tire sidewalls without passing their prescribed testing. Currently the prescribed testing is explained below.

DETERMINING TIRE SPEED RATING:

Speed ratings are the product of laboratory testing – with simulated speeds and loads. To receive any kind of rating, a tire must demonstrate that it’s capable of sustaining a particular speed. Industry standards govern the process of reaching and maintaining a given speed during a test.
